- Skin type: Combination dehydrated skin - Key ingredients and fragrance: • Main ingredients are fermented components like Fusicoccum coccineum, Bifidobacterium, and Lactobacillus ferment filtrate • Glycerin and 1,3-butylene glycol provide hydration • Vitamin B5 (panthenol) keeps skin soft and smooth • Powerful antioxidant Vitamin E (tocopherol) aids in skin regeneration and elasticity • Gentle preservative 1,2-hexanediol is used • Fragrance-free with no allergens - Texture: • Slightly heavy and rich texture • Apply a small amount to hands, warm it up, then gently blend into skin (creates a protective layer) • Suitable for very dry or extremely dry skin year-round, recommended for oily skin in winter - Effects: • Fermented ingredients have smaller particles and increased potency of beneficial components like organic acids, amino acids, and vitamins • Quickly absorbs and repairs damaged skin barrier • Can be applied to face and body for intense hydration and to address flaking skin Contains fatty acids like palmitic acid and stearic acid, which may clog pores and potentially cause blemishes or acne for those with oily skin Due to its rich texture, warm the product between your fingers before applying to help it blend seamlessly into your skin - Hwahae UserCombination SkinSensitive SkinDec 24, 2021
Skin type: Combination + Combination dehydrated skin + Sensitive. In my youth, I had oily, acne-prone skin, but as an adult, I developed thin, sensitive skin prone to atopic dermatitis. Depending on the cosmetics I use, I can get blemishes or small bumps, and if I don't apply anything, my skin quickly becomes dry. Texture: Rich consistency. While not quite a balm, it's quite thick for a cream. However, when applied to the skin, it doesn't feel heavy or drag; instead, it spreads smoothly and easily. User experience: It feels like a solid protective barrier on my thin skin. In this winter weather, the power of your morning skincare routine before makeup is crucial. I needed a rich cream to lock in moisture over my usual cream, and this one applies with the thickness I was hoping for. When I use this cream as the final step in my skincare routine, it feels like it keeps my skin hydrated until I cleanse in the evening, without evaporating. Looking at the ingredients, I see 'Fusidium coccineum', which is apparently a medicinal ointment ingredient adapted for cosmetic use. In my opinion, it seems the key ingredient is similar to that in Fusi* ointment used for wounds. As it's an ointment ingredient for healing wounds, it definitely gave me the impression of strengthening the barrier of my thin skin. After diligently applying it for about three days, I noticed a few blemishes appearing, which I had been slightly worried about. It seems it might have been too rich for my skin. Looking at the ingredients, I see there are some pore-clogging components. For combination skin like mine, I'd recommend using it only in the evening or applying a small amount each time. This could be the perfect item for those with thin, dry skin who don't have to worry about blemishes! - Hwahae UserCombination SkinAcne SkinSensitive SkinDec 18, 2021
